Artworks by Pakistani calligrapher exhibited in Barcelona
BARCELONA: An exhibition of a Pakistani calligrapher’s artworks was organized at the Consulate General of Pakistan in Barcelona, Spain.
The event was held to showcase the works of the young renowned artist, Tahir Bin Qalandar. Pakistan’s Consul General in Barcelona Murad Ali Wazir was chief guest of the event. Speaking on the occasion, the consul general welcomed Qalandar to Barcelona and informed the participants about his artworks.
The consul general praised the talent of Qalandar and said that his artworks had the best combination of colors, creativity and spirituality. He said color doesn’t need language it speaks its own language.
The audience appreciated the work of the young artist. The ceremony was presided over by the Consul General of Barcelona Murad Ali Wazir. Waheed Khattak performed the duties of stage secretary.
The ceremony began with the recitation from the Holy Quran and Naat Rasool Maqbool.
